在亚马逊网络服务EC2上,尝试从集群容器连接到私有RDS实例。它在容器内部失败,但在主机上工作良好。我非常确定这与集群中的网络有关,因为如果我做了docker run,我就能够连接到数据库。Docker版本- Client: API version: 1.39 OS/Arch: linux/amd64
Ex
我有一个python应用程序,我想要连接到sqs并从它接收消息。我试图通过docker在EC2上运行这个应用程序,但当我这样做时,我得到了botocore.exceptions.EndpointConnectionError: Could not connect to直接从python在我的本地机器上运行,从docker在我的本地机器上运行,从python直接在EC2中运行,从docker在EC2中运行。前3个场景我没有得到错误,所以我认为这与AWS权限无关。src
EX
我有一个由3个相互连接的节点组成的领事集群,用于故障转移。问题是,我只能将我的swarm worker和master连接到单个节点,如果该节点宕机,那么swarm将停止工作。那么,如何将swarm workers和masters连接到我的所有节点呢?如果从主服务器运行以下命令,将设置连接到单个consul服务器的swarm环境: #### REFERENCE
# {{master_i}} is the IP address of the master-
根据Docker文档,当我们初始化dockerswarm时,会自动创建覆盖网络。但是我们不能将该网络用于不属于群资源的单个码头容器。我尝试创建可连接的覆盖网络,但收到以下错误: docker network create -d overlay --attachable my-attachable-overlay
Error responsefrom daemon: This node is not a swarm manager.Use "docker <